#748687 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#748687 is composed of 45.5% red, 52.5% green and 52.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 14.1% cyan, 0.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 47.1% black. It has a hue angle of 183.2 degrees, a saturation of 7.6% and a lightness of 49.2%. #748687 color hex could be obtained by blending #e8ffff with #000d0f. Closest websafe color is: #669999.

Shades and Tints of #748687
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070808 is the darkest color, while #fdfdf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#748687
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#748687 is the less saturated color, while #00eefb is the most saturated one.
